Add backend unit tests
- Add unit testing code in backend/tests/ - Change to snake-case for script/file/directory names - Use os.path.join() instead of '/' - Refactor script code into function defs and a main-guard - Make global vars all-caps Some fixes: - For getting descriptions, some wiki redirects weren't properly resolved - Linked images were sub-optimally propagated - Generation of reduced trees assumed a wiki-id association implied a description - Tilo.py had potential null dereferences by not always using a reduced node set - EOL image downloading didn't properly wait for all threads to end when finishing

+"""
+Maps otol IDs to EOL and enwiki titles, using IDs from various
+other sources (like NCBI).
+
+Reads otol taxonomy data to get source IDs for otol IDs,
+then looks up those IDs in an EOL provider_ids file,
+and in a wikidata dump, and stores results in the database.
+
+Based on code from https://github.com/OneZoom/OZtree, located in
+OZprivate/ServerScripts/TaxonMappingAndPopularity/ (22 Aug 2022).
+"""
